Why Uber and Lyft Accidents Are Different from Regular Car Accidents in Denver
Rideshare accidents are often more complicated than standard car accident claims because Uber and Lyft operate as transportation network companies, or TNCs. Unlike traditional drivers, rideshare drivers work through app-based platforms that use different insurance coverage depending on the driver’s status at the time of the crash.
These claims may involve multiple parties, overlapping insurance policies, and disputes over liability that are not usually present in other car accident cases.

Who Can File a Claim After a Denver Uber or Lyft Accident?
Several different people may have the right to pursue compensation after a rideshare accident. Determining if you can file a Lyft or Uber accident claim often depends on how the accident happened, your role in the crash, and which insurance coverage applies.
Passengers injured during an Uber or Lyft ride may be able to file a claim through the rideshare company’s insurance coverage. Other drivers injured in a crash involving a rideshare vehicle may also have claims against the at-fault driver or applicable rideshare insurance policies.
Pedestrians and cyclists struck by an Uber or Lyft driver may have the right to pursue compensation for medical expenses, lost income, and other damages related to their injuries.
Who Is Liable in a Rideshare Accident?
Several parties may be responsible for a rideshare accident, depending on how the crash occurred and who was involved. Liability may include:
- Uber or Lyft insurance coverage: If the rideshare driver was actively using the app at the time of the accident, Uber or Lyft’s insurance coverage likely applies to the claim.
- The Uber or Lyft driver: A rideshare driver may be responsible if distracted driving, speeding, unsafe lane changes, or other negligent behavior caused the accident.
- Another driver: In some crashes, another motorist may be fully or partly responsible for causing the collision.
- Third parties: Vehicle manufacturers, maintenance providers, or property owners may share liability if defective equipment or unsafe conditions contributed to the accident.
What Compensation Can You Recover After a Denver Uber or Lyft Accident?
An Uber or Lyft accident can leave you dealing with far more than just vehicle damage. You may be able to recover compensation for both financial losses and personal hardships connected to the crash.
Economic damages may include medical expenses, future medical treatment, lost income, reduced earning ability, rehabilitation costs, and property damage. You may also be able to recover non-economic damages for pain and suffering, emotional distress, trauma, and the ways the injury has affected your daily life and overall well-being.
In some cases involving reckless or intentional conduct, additional damages may also be available. The amount of compensation in a rideshare accident claim will depend on factors such as the severity of the injuries, the impact on your daily life, available insurance coverage, and who was responsible for the crash.
What to Do After an Uber or Lyft Accident in Denver
The steps you take after a rideshare accident can affect both your health and your ability to recover compensation later. After an accident, try to:
- Seek immediate medical care: Prompt treatment helps protect your health and creates medical documentation connected to the accident.
- Call the police after an accident: Reporting the crash helps create an official car accident police report in Denver that may later support your claim.
- Gather information: Collect names, contact information, insurance details, and rideshare information from everyone involved.
- Document the scene: Take photos of vehicle damage, injuries, traffic conditions, road hazards, and anything else that may help explain how the crash happened.
- Report the accident through the Uber or Lyft app: Reporting the crash through the app helps create an official rideshare incident record.
- Be cautious when speaking with insurers: Insurance companies may look for statements they can use to reduce or deny your claim.
How Long Do You Have to File a Rideshare Accident Claim in Colorado?
Colorado law limits the amount of time you have to file a rideshare accident claim. Under Colorado’s statute of limitations, people injured in motor vehicle accidents generally have three years from the date of the crash to file a lawsuit. However, if a loved one dies in a rideshare accident, you may have as little as two years from the death to file suit. In addition, cases involving government entities have shorter filing deadlines.

Common Injuries Seen in Denver Rideshare Accidents
Uber and Lyft accidents can cause serious physical and emotional injuries, especially during high-speed collisions, sudden stops, or crashes at busy Denver intersections.
Common injuries may include broken bones, head and brain injuries, neck and back injuries, spinal cord damage, and soft tissue injuries. Many people also experience emotional effects such as anxiety, trauma, or post-traumatic stress after a serious rideshare accident.
FAQs About Uber and Lyft Accidents in Denver
What if I Am Injured as a Passenger in an Uber Accident?
If you were a passenger in an Uber accident, you may have the right to pursue compensation through Uber’s insurance coverage or a policy covering another liable party involved in the crash.
Can I Sue Uber or Lyft Directly?
In some situations, you may be able to pursue legal action against Uber or Lyft. Rideshare companies often argue they aren’t responsible for accidents because their drivers are independent contractors rather than employees. However, the rideshare companies may be liable for their own negligence.
What if the Rideshare Driver Was Not at Fault?
If the rideshare driver was not at fault, you may still be able to pursue compensation from another driver or party responsible for causing the accident.
